Delayed extraction improves specificity in database searches by matrix-assisted laser desorption/ionization peptide

O N Jensen1, A Podtelejnikov, M Mann

  • 1Protein & Peptide Group, European Molecular Biology Laboratory, Heidelberg, Germany.

Rapid Communications in Mass Spectrometry : RCM
|January 1, 1996
PubMed
Summary

Delayed ion extraction coupled with MALDI time-of-flight mass spectrometry significantly enhances protein identification. This technique improves database search specificity and accuracy, enabling faster and more comprehensive protein analysis.

Area of Science:

  • Proteomics
  • Analytical Chemistry
  • Biochemistry

Background:

  • Peptide mass mapping using MALDI is a common method for protein identification via database searches.
  • Existing methods face limitations in specificity and accuracy for complex analyses.

Purpose of the Study:

  • To evaluate the impact of delayed ion-extraction on MALDI time-of-flight mass spectrometry for protein identification.
  • To demonstrate the enhanced specificity and accuracy offered by this improved technique.

Main Methods:

  • Utilized delayed ion-extraction coupled with reflectron MALDI time-of-flight mass spectrometry.
  • Analyzed peptide mass maps generated from protein samples.
  • Performed database searches using the obtained mass accuracy data.

Main Results:

  • Achieved routine resolution between 6,000 and 12,000, enabling monoisotopic mass assignment.
  • Demonstrated high mass accuracy (<30 ppm over wide range, <5 ppm over narrow range).
  • Observed improved signal-to-noise ratio, allowing assignment of low-intensity peaks and increased sequence coverage.

Conclusions:

  • Delayed ion-extraction significantly enhances the specificity and precision of MALDI-TOF MS for protein identification.
  • This advanced technique facilitates protein identification with fewer peptides and improves the analysis of protein mixtures.
  • Delayed-extraction MALDI-TOF MS represents a powerful tool for robust protein database identification.
